CHROMIUMOS: mac80211: Use different probe counts on resume

We recently increased the probe retry count for beacon monitoring
in order to make challenging channel conditions less volatile.  In
doing so, we made the system slower to respond to a lost AP when the
system resumes from suspend.  Mitigate this by using a different
try-count for the resume-from-suspend case.

BUG=chromium-os:28576
TEST=Manual: Suspend, unplug AP, resume.  Observe disconnection in < 1sec
